Good Points: Nostalgia, rugged and fast shooting for a non-CO2 repeater
Bad Points: Everything else
General comments: I got the NRA Centennial version in '71. The spring broke on me once (my fault), other than that it's been completely reliable.
It struggles to break 100fps and sometimes bounces off a carboard box. Accuracy isn't something it aspires to, although it's not quite as bad as my Marksman 1010. Realism isn't its strong suit, either.
I find it's most fun for killing (or rather denting) cans at 15 feet - line up a half dozen, and try to get them as fast as possible. It's not completely useless for "point and shoot" practice.
